In the same week that Nick Saban retired from Alabama, Bill Belichick and the New England Patriots parted ways. It feels like many of us don’t know a world without Belichick and Saban leading their respective teams because they had such long and successful tenures, but the expression “all good things must come to an end” feels rather fitting here.

The question for Belichick is what happens now? Where does he go? Is this the end for the 72-year-old or does he have something left to prove with another team? DraftKings Sportsbook has odds on what Belichick’s next role will be and the favorite may surprise you.

Is it possible that Belichick will truly ride off into the sunset? That’s the favorite at +150, at least for the upcoming 2024 season. Surely it’s possible that Bill takes some time and picks it up in 2025, but this would seem like “retirement or bust” as a coach. That said, this option would also cash if Belichick was to join a front office or be an advisor, as he’s not the head coach, which is the important distinction here and with the wording of the bet itself.

For Belichick to join the Falcons (+200), Desmond Ridder and Taylor Heinicke would not cut it. The Falcons would have to make some costly moves, either from a spending standpoint or to move up in the NFL Draft. Owner Arthur Blank has been around a long time and would likely love to work with Belichick. The weather is better and the games are in a dome. Is that a selling point for Belichick?
